原文:_mysql_exceptions.OperationalError: (2013, 'Lost connection to MySQL server during query')

最近写了一个定时脚本,每天凌晨跑,每次跑时间很长。 在测试这个脚本的时候,跑了一个小时,发生一个错误,脚本中断,错误如下: mysql exceptions.OperationalError: , Lost connection to MySQL server during query 查阅资料,请教同事,最后得出结论: 因为mysql有一个默认的connect timeout时间,一旦超过,会自 ...

2018-03-30 22:10 0 2578 推荐指数:

查看详情

pymysql.err.OperationalError: (2013, 'Lost connection to MySQL server during query')

pymysql错误: 错误原因: MySQL持久化链接保持时间为8小时(28800秒),过期后断开连。如果数据库没有新建连接,则会报此错。 解决思路: 调用前判断连接是否有效,如果有效继续,无效创建连接。 鸣谢地址: python mysql使用 ...

Tue May 07 00:40:00 CST 2019 0 4394
flask_sqlalchemy 2013 Lost connection to MySQL server during query

在使用flask_sqlalchemy的时候,每当长时间未请求(5分钟,为啥时5分钟,往下看),当再一次使用连接的时候,就会报 python pymysql.err.OperationalError: (2013, 'Lost connection to MySQL server during ...

Thu Jul 16 23:28:00 CST 2020 0 1436
Django Lost connection to MySQL server during query

实际的原因在于mysql 设置的timeout大于你的脚本执行时间,导致django的查询超时。 登录mysql可以查看mysql wait_timeout: django为了减少不必要的数据库连接、关闭,复用了数据库连接,当开始一个请求后建立一个连接池存放连接,之后此次 ...

Thu Aug 27 22:42:00 CST 2020 0 684
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M